lib/fog/azurerm/models/resources/resource_groups.rb in fog-azure-rm-0.0.4 vs lib/fog/azurerm/models/resources/resource_groups.rb in fog-azure-rm-0.0.5
- old
+ new
@@ -8,10 +8,14 @@
# check name availability for resource groups.
class ResourceGroups < Fog::Collection
model Fog::Resources::AzureRM::ResourceGroup
def all
- load(service.list_resource_groups)
+ resource_groups = []
+ service.list_resource_groups.each do |resource_group|
+ resource_groups.push(Fog::Resources::AzureRM::ResourceGroup.parse(resource_group))
+ end
+ load(resource_groups)
end
def get(identity)
all.find { |f| f.name == identity }
end